* * ''Odyssey'' is the next in line to have an awesome, yet difficult, final level: Culmina Crater, located on the darkest part of the moon, starts you off with a crowd cheering you on, consisting of every race you've helped along your journey: Toads, Bonneters, Tosterenans, Lochladies, Steam Gardeners, New Donkers (including Pauline, who's once again singing "[[SugarWiki/AwesomeMusic Jump Up, Super Star!"), Shiverians, Bubblainians, and Volbonans all gather to watch your success as you use a Frog to hop up to the entrance. And from there, every phase just gets even better.
** Starting off with am optional mini-boss that gives you an extra three hit points if you beat it, followed by some nifty platforming across sinking platforms and poles, swinging across bars, and using a Lava Bubble to hop the rest of the way to the cannon to the next area.
** Capturing an Uproot and using its abilities to go further up, swimming across freezing cold water, then using [[spoiler:Yoshi's tongue]] to climb up the conveyor belts to the next location.
** Running across flowery roads where you can go off the beaten path and answer the Sphynx's last quiz, which he rewards you with a ton of coins if you get these questions right, as well as an extra three hit points if you don't have them already.
** Going through an obstacle course where you have to go without your cap, jumping across a series of protruding blocks.
** Possessing Glydon in what looks like a cross between ''VideoGame/SuperMarioGalaxy2's'' second Fluzzard level and ''VideoGame/TheLegendOfZeldaTheWindWaker's'' Flight Control Platform, gliding through whirlwinds and dodging Urban Stingbies as they try to blow up right in your face, before flinging across a few Volbonans to the next locale.
** Fighting off Burrbos on a single, slow-moving platform while potentially dodging shock wave upon shock wave.
** Using a Pokio to swing across wooden pendulums, potentially the trickiest part in the entire level, even ''after'' realizing [[spoiler:you can hook into the rock face]]!
** The final 8-bit level, where you have to dodge sporadically appearing barrels in order to reach and knock off Donkey Kong.
